Oxytocin Receptor Signaling in Vascular Function and Stroke

open access: yesFrontiers in Neuroscience, 2020
The oxytocin receptor (OXTR) is a G protein-coupled receptor with a diverse repertoire of intracellular signaling pathways, which are activated in response to binding oxytocin (OXT) and a similar nonapeptide, vasopressin.

New Topics in Vasopressin Receptors and Approach to Novel Drugs: Vasopressin and Pain Perception

open access: yesJournal of Pharmacological Sciences, 2009
Arginine vasopressin (AVP) activates three vasopressin receptors and it also has an agonistic activity on the oxytocin receptor. For an accurate description of the target receptor subtype(s) responsible for complex AVP and oxytocin actions, a careful ...
